Premier League agree on winter break
The English Premier League tonight voted in favour of the principle of introducing a winter break during the football season.
Chairmen from the top flight gave the green light to a two-year experiment whereby there will be a two-week break in January – as long as a balanced fixture schedule can be formulated and all the practical differences can be overcome.
If so, the experiment will begin next season, 2004-05, and continue for the following season before being reviewed.
